SGN to BOM on Global Explorer

Hi,
I'm thinking of doing a J global explorer from BOM>europe>us>SGN>BOM.

I have to go to Saigon for a friend's wedding; vietnam is ruled out on on OWE, but not global explorer.

Mileage isn't really a problem. but time is, and the only oneworld options i see for saigon>bom are a transfer in HKG or SYD, both of which would involve an overnight stay.

I could do same-day SGN>HGK>DEL trip, but would rather land in BOM.

As I understand it, I'm not allowed to do a surface sector (buy a o/w on vietname airlines from SGN>BKK) to pick up the BKK>BOM flight on CX.

Is there an option that I am missing?

thanks for the info, but...

Wasabi,
Thanks for the guidance. The OWE thread with a sticky on this forum says

"Asia - No tickets to Vietnam or Cambodia permitted."

You motivated me to look in the starfile, which reads:
146N FOR TICKETS ISSUED ON/BEFORE 30JUN05, TRAVEL NOT
147N PERMITTED ON CX BETWEEN HONG KONG AND VIETNAM.

So i guess travel to vietname is permitted on OWE (yay).

But for surface sector, it reads:
153N 4. ORIGIN-DESTINATION SURFACE PERMITTED:
154N .
155N . * WITHIN THE COUNTRY OF ORIGIN
156N . * BETWEEN USA AND CANADA
157N . * BETWEEN HKG AND CHINA
158N . * WITHIN AFRICA
159N . * WITHIN SOUTH AMERICA
160N . * BETWEEN BANGLADESH AND BKK/SIN
161N . * BETWEEN MALAYSIA AND SIN


Which seems to rule out SGN-BKK, right?

Originally Posted by Shawn02139
Which seems to rule out SGN-BKK, right?
This is because SGN-HKG is operated under a JSA (Joint Services Agreement) between CX and VN and VN obviously is not a OW carrier. I think OW Explorer fares are only allowed to have revenue shared between alliance carriers (unlike Global Explorer fares) and obviously the VN/CX JSA would mean that revenue on HKG-SGN flights would get split between alliance and non-alliance carriers which is against their agreement.

Other OW JSA routes include the LON-BCN/MAD between BA and IB and MEL/SYD-LHR(via SIN, BKK and HKG) between QF and BA. I think there might even be a JSA between LA and AA but I cannot remember any details. Obviously all these JSAs are between OW carriers so there are no issues.
